Associations to the word «Bacchant»

Wiktionary

BACCHANT, noun. A priest of Bacchus.
BACCHANT, noun. A bacchanal; a reveler.
BACCHANT, adjective. Bacchanalian; fond of drunken revelry; wine-loving; reveling; carousing.

Dictionary definition

BACCHANT, noun. Someone who engages in drinking bouts.
BACCHANT, noun. A drunken reveller; a devotee of Bacchus.
BACCHANT, noun. (classical mythology) a priest or votary of Bacchus.
